Spindrift Cranberry Punch pairs well with a variety of whiskeys, including bourbon, and guests can mix up their own iteration of the cocktail depending on their liquor preference. Gin and rum would certainly work too, and mezcal can add a smoky note for a rustic autumnal twist.

For hosting, the two-ingredient drink is easy to serve guests on demand or to set up as a station with cans, whiskey, ice cubes, and glasses. To amp it up a level, add some fun garnishes to the cocktail. Ice cubes with fresh cranberries frozen in them look great, and the drink can be garnished with fresh sprigs of rosemary or thyme, citrus wedges, or even a cinnamon stick. Sober folks can also enjoy the sparkler with a non-alcoholic spirit or just by dressing up a glass of Spindrift on the rocks.

Highballs are some of the easiest cocktails to make, as they’re built in the glass. All you need is the sparkling water, liquor, and ice, plus a bar spoon or straw to stir. The classic ratio for highballs is 2 ounces of whiskey to 4 ounces of chilled soda water, but just 1 ounce of whiskey is fine (also ideal if you’re planning to have more than one).

To make the drink, fill a highball glass or any tall glass with ice. Add the whiskey, top off with Spindrift, give the drink a slight stir, garnish, and it’s ready. Cheers!
